FAQ

Common Questions About Social Media in Leeds

How long before we see leads from social media?+
Organic reach builds over 8–12 weeks (content consistency compounds). Paid campaigns generate qualified leads within 2–3 weeks if your funnel is set up. By month 4–6, social is typically your second-largest lead source after paid search, with significantly lower cost per lead.
Do you manage our paid ads, or just organic?+
We manage both. Organic content builds community and brand; paid campaigns (Facebook, Instagram, LinkedIn) retarget warm audiences and accelerate lead flow. Most clients invest £400–£800/month in ads; we optimise spend to hit your cost-per-lead target.
What if our team doesn't have time to engage with comments and DMs?+
That's exactly what we do. We manage community (responding within 4 hours), qualify leads in messenger, and send them to your CRM. Your agents close deals; we build the pipeline and manage the conversation layer.
How is this different from hiring an in-house social media person?+
An in-house hire costs £22k–£28k/year + onboarding time. We cost £1,000–£2,500/month with no hiring overhead, access to real estate expertise across 50+ clients, and proven systems. You also get strategic oversight, not just posting.
Will this work for luxury properties (£500k+)?+
Yes—in fact, luxury properties benefit most. High-net-worth buyers research extensively on Instagram and LinkedIn before engaging. We build authority, showcase lifestyle, and create exclusivity through content. Our luxury case studies show 5.8%+ engagement rates and £1.12 cost per qualified lead.
What platforms should we focus on?+
For residential sales: Instagram (visual storytelling) + Facebook (retargeting + local community) + LinkedIn (upsizing families, commercial). For lettings/BTL: Facebook (investor networks) + LinkedIn (developer relationships) + Instagram (lifestyle appeal). We recommend all three; we optimise budget allocation based on your buyer personas.
How do you measure success? What should we expect month-to-month?+
Months 1–2: Content consistency, follower growth, engagement baseline. Months 3–4: Lead flow from social, cost-per-lead tracking, ROAS on ads. Months 5–6: Optimisation, 30–45% reduction in cost per lead vs. portals, repeatable system. You get a monthly dashboard showing followers, engagement, leads, cost per lead, and ROAS.
